Concert Program VIII: Bridging Dvořák

SEE EVENT DETAILS
at Stent Family Hall, Menlo School (see times)
The 2014 season concludes with a linear perspective on Dvořák’s art, from the work of Smetana, Bohemia’s musical patriarch, to that of modern Hungarian and Czech composers. Following Dohnányi’s dynamic Serenade for String Trio, the program offers the haunting String Sextet of Erwin Schulhoff. Dvořák’s glorious Piano Quintet answers the resolute strains of Schulhoff’s sextet with a message of transcendent beauty.
